u/MattSzaszko European motocamper 2d ago
Any ultralight backpacking gear will do the job. But your bike can haul more than that. You don't have to go for the expensive ultralight gear and you can easily carry luxury items that make camping a lot more fun. There are so many Japanese motocampers who are into the vintage inspired camping vibe and they can haul even with a Honda Cub, try to find some for inspiration on Instagram. For a tent I can recommend Naturehike, great value for money. As a rule always go for a 2 person tent for a solo rider, the extra space will come in handy for your gear.
I think figuring out your luggage situation first is crucial and then you can get into assembling your gear list. You don't need much in the end, shelter and a way to sleep (pad and bag) and that's about it. The rest you can figure out as you go.

u/KingPurple13 2d ago
Best piece of advice I can give you is the same advice that was given to me. #1 pick the most comfortable bed that you can still haul and setup (cot, sleeping pad, hammock, etc..). Quality sleep is easily the difference between a bad trip and a great trip. Don’t settle! #2 pack a chair of some kind, preferably one with a back on it. Having somewhere to sit that’s not hard and not sitting on the ground will greatly help you decompress and let your body rest without having to lay down in your bed or crawl into a hammock.

u/Indiesol 2d ago
I would recommend having a local fabricator make some pannier racks for your bike if there's nothing available on the market, and getting some side cases, at least. It makes life SOOOOO much easier, even without adding a top box (but panniers and a top box is the best for camping).
